This school is a caring community which educates young people by giving individual attention to each pupil's needs. We are a small school and take full advantage of our size. Teachers and pupils know each other very well and are keen to provide mutual support.
We foster academic, creative and sporting growth, social responsibility, integrity cooperation and an awareness of global issues.